Data doing the nerve pinch on TNG was fine because unlike a mind meld it didn’t require any telepathic powers. The reason humans cannot do the nerve pinch (or at least they couldn’t until Michael Bernam on Discovery :rolleyes::rolleyes::rolleyes:) was because they’re not physically strong enough. That wouldn’t be a problem for Data who’s far stronger than a Vulcan.
